Understanding the Danish Football League System
Before we jump into the fixtures, it's essential to understand how the Danish football league system works. The top tier is known as the Danish Superliga, where the best teams battle it out for the championship. Below that, you have the Danish 1st Division, followed by the 2nd Division and so on. Each league has its own set of fixtures and schedules, so knowing where your favorite team plays is crucial.
The Danish Superliga, established in 1991, marks the pinnacle of professional football in Denmark. It typically features 12 to 14 teams, competing in a round-robin format, where each team plays the others multiple times, both at home and away. This structure ensures a balanced and competitive season. The Superliga operates on a promotion and relegation system with the Danish 1st Division. The teams that finish at the bottom of the Superliga table are relegated to the 1st Division, while the top teams from the 1st Division are promoted to the Superliga. This system encourages competition and allows for dynamic changes in the league composition each season.
Teams in the Superliga often participate in various cup competitions, such as the Danish Cup (Sydbank Pokalen), which offers another avenue for silverware and a chance to qualify for European competitions. European qualification is a significant incentive for Superliga teams, with the top teams earning spots in prestigious tournaments like the UEFA Champions League and the UEFA Europa League (or the UEFA Europa Conference League). These opportunities not only enhance the prestige of the clubs but also provide significant financial benefits. The Superliga season usually runs from July to May, aligning with the typical European football calendar. The mid-season break, usually in December and January, allows players to rest and teams to strategize for the second half of the season. This break is crucial for maintaining player fitness and preventing burnout, ensuring that teams are in top condition for the crucial matches in the spring.
The Danish 1st Division, known as NordicBet Liga for sponsorship reasons, serves as the second-highest level in Danish football. It's a crucial league for teams aspiring to reach the top tier, the Superliga, and for those aiming to stabilize their position in professional football. The league typically comprises 12 teams, each vying for promotion. The format includes a series of home and away matches, ensuring a balanced competition where every team faces each other multiple times throughout the season. At the end of the season, the top teams in the 1st Division are promoted to the Superliga, while the bottom teams face relegation to the 2nd Division. This promotion and relegation system creates a dynamic environment, fostering ambition among clubs and ensuring a constant influx of new talent and strategies.
For many clubs, participation in the 1st Division is a stepping stone towards greater success. It provides an opportunity to develop players, refine tactics, and build a strong team capable of competing at the highest level. The league is also an important platform for young talents to showcase their skills and attract attention from larger clubs, both domestically and internationally. Impact of Fixtures on Team Performance
The arrangement of fixtures in a football league has a profound impact on team performance, influencing everything from player fitness to overall strategy. A well-structured schedule can provide a balanced challenge, allowing teams to showcase their abilities consistently, while a poorly planned one can lead to undue stress and inconsistent results. Understanding how fixtures affect team dynamics is crucial for both fans and analysts.
One of the primary considerations is match congestion. Teams that have to play multiple high-stakes games in quick succession often struggle with fatigue and injuries. This is particularly true in leagues where teams also participate in cup competitions or international tournaments. The physical toll of frequent matches can lead to decreased performance, as players are unable to recover adequately between games. Coaches must carefully manage their squad, rotating players to avoid burnout and maintaining a competitive edge. The strategic use of substitutions and tactical adjustments becomes even more critical during periods of high match density.
Home and away games also play a significant role in team performance. Teams generally perform better at home due to the support of their fans, familiarity with the pitch, and the comfort of their own facilities. The psychological advantage of playing in front of a home crowd can boost morale and confidence, leading to improved results. Conversely, away games often present challenges, as teams must adapt to different environments, deal with hostile fans, and overcome travel fatigue. The ability to secure points away from home is often a hallmark of a successful team, demonstrating resilience and adaptability.
The strength of opponents is another critical factor. A team's schedule can be significantly affected by the sequence of matches against strong or weak opponents. Facing a series of tough opponents can be daunting, requiring a high level of preparation and tactical flexibility. Such periods can test a team's resolve and expose any weaknesses in their game plan. On the other hand, a run of easier games can provide an opportunity to build momentum, boost morale, and experiment with different strategies. However, it is essential for teams not to become complacent during these periods and to maintain a high level of focus and intensity.
